Mexican singer shot dead by husband inside restaurant
A 21-year-old singer has been shot to death by her elderly husband in a restaurant after trying to divorce him for months.


Mexico City: Yrma Lydya, a 21-year-old singer has been shot to death by her elderly husband in a restaurant after trying to divorce him for months.
According to details, Lydya was shot down by her 79-year-old husband identified as Jesus Hernandez in her private room at a Japanese restaurant in Mexico City.
The incident happened last Thursday as the folk singer was, reportedly, eating at the restaurant when the accused allegedly shot her three times in the chest.
It is also alleged that he and his bodyguard, then attempted to flee the scene in a luxury car before being pursued by police.
Reports claim that Hernandez then tried to bribe officers to let him go.
The horrifying murder came after Lydya contacted a law firm in April about starting divorce proceedings.
Earlier, the singer had posted photos of her bruised face after several domestic abuse cases. Lydya also filed a police report in December that her husband beat her and threatened her with a gun on another occasion.
Hernandez and his bodyguard appeared in court on Sunday and are currently being held in pre-trial detention at a Mexico City prison as police continue to investigate.
